Murina jaintiana

Ruedi, J. Biswas, & Csorba, 2012

Jaintia Tube-nosed Bat

Taxonomy

Subclass : Theria
Infraclass : Placentalia
Magnorder : Boreoeutheria
Superorder : Laurasiatheria
Order : Chiroptera
Suborder : Vespertilioniformes
Superfamily : Vespertilionoidea
Family : Vespertilionidae
Subfamily : Murininae
Genus : Murina

Species status

Living
Found in the wild

Authority citation

Ruedi, M., Biswas, J. and Csorba, G. 2012. Bats from the wet: two new species of tube-nosed bats (Chiroptera: Vespertilionidae) from Meghalaya, India. Revue suisse de Zoologie 119(1):111-135.

Original name as described

Murina jaintiana

Type material

MHNG 1976.072

Type kind

holotype

Type locality

"India, Meghalaya, Jaintia Hills, 2.3 km east of the village of Kseh, 720 m a.s.l; geographic coordinates: N 25°26', E 92°36'."

Biogeographic realm

Indomalaya

Country distribution

India · Myanmar

Taxonomy notes

recently described

Taxonomy notes citation

Ruedi, M., Biswas, J., & Csorba, G. (2012). Bats from the wet: two new species of Tube-nosed bats(Chiroptera: Vespertilionidae) from Meghalaya, India. Revue suisse de Zoologie, 119(1), 111-135.

IUCN Red List status

Not Evaluated
